Sat, Jun 13, 2015 at 08:04:29PM CEST, sfel...@gmail.com wrote: >From: Scott Feldman <sfel...@gmail.com> > >If device flags ingress packet as "fwd offload", mark the skb->fwd_mark >using the ingress port's dev->fwd_mark. This will be the hint to the >kernel that this packet has already been forwarded by device to egress >ports matching skb->fwd_mark. > >For rocker, derive port dev->fwd_mark based on device switch ID. This will look the same for all drivers, so I think it should be in common swithdev core, always generated according to "switch id".
